Total Depravity - Written: 10/6/2005

While we may not be the most sinful civilization in history, I believe that we are likely the most depraved and potentially deceived. How did I arrive at this conclusion? Well, we have more books, teaching resources and tools to help spread the Gospel than ever before. We have a greater anointing of the Holy Spirit after the resurrection than before it. We have a long established history of Christianity.

Today, the average person in modern societies have a greater level of affluence, technology and opportunity than at any previous time in human history. Man has accomplished scientific miracles over the past 100 years that boggle the mind. From the atomic bomb to discovering DNA to exploring the depths of the ocean, human achievement has decreased our apparent need for God all the while exposing the great genius of how creation works. Society has embraced postmodern thought and created an atmosphere where everyone can become a god. For many people, they create god in their image and according to their desires. Nothing seems to be right or wrong.

And our prosperity, especially in Western nations, has made us arrogant, selfish and depraved. Many do not see their need for God. People seek fulfillment in everything else but God.

Nothing seems sinful any more. In the minds of many people, sin has been reduced to simple mistakes. It has become a popular hobby to dismiss our responsibility for our actions.

Society wants to call good evil and evil good. Gross sexual sin is rampant throughout society. It has tainted huge percentages of people who claim to be Christians too. Pornography is everywhere now. What people watch for entertainment is remarkably violent, mostly void of morals, and full of ungodly sexual messages and images. We slaughter millions of innocent children every year in the name of convenience. Sin is rampant.

When you consider Sodom and Gomorrah, those who worshipped Baal, and the gross brutality and sensuality of the Roman Empire, there are a lot of other really sinful times in history. But we have more advantages and knowledge than any other. We know more about the brain and the body than any other civilization. We have far superior technology and wealth. Despite the advantages, our gross sin and high level of knowledge reveals our great depravity. We have been given much and have little to show for it from a spiritual development perspective. The world has been given over to a depraved mind. And it is our responsibility to be Christ's messengers to redeem creation.
